Ordinals
beta
Sat 1869254920134379
decimal
63386.1120134379
percentile
3.738509840268758%
name
mbxqifvquohq
cycle
0
epoch
2
block
63386
offset
1120134379
timestamp
2024-03-06 06:13:14 UTC
rarity
common
prev
next